Factors to Consider When Choosing Drones For Beginners On Amazon

When choosing a drone for beginners on Amazon, several factors influence your experience and satisfaction. It’s important to match the drone’s features with your skills and goals, whether casual flying or learning photography. Considering ease of control, safety features, and durability can prevent frustration and accidents. Price is often tied to features, so understanding what matters most to you will help avoid overpaying for unnecessary specs or missing out on critical beginner-friendly features. Below are key considerations to keep in mind during your purchase.

Ease of Use and Flight Stability

For beginners, straightforward controls and stable flight are essential. Look for drones with features like altitude hold and headless mode, which make flying less intimidating. These simplify complicated maneuvers and help new pilots focus on basic flying skills without constantly correcting drift or orientation issues. Avoid overly complex models with advanced features that can overwhelm new users, unless you’re specifically interested in learning those skills from the start.

Battery Life and Flight Time

Longer flight times mean fewer crashes and more practice between charges, which is a major advantage for beginners. Most entry-level drones offer 10-30 minutes of flight, but models with extended battery options or quick-swap batteries can significantly improve your experience. Keep in mind that more flight time usually comes with a higher price, so balancing cost with your desired flying duration is key. Shorter flights might be manageable if you’re just practicing takeoffs and landings, but they can become frustrating when trying to master controls.

Camera Quality and Photography Features

If capturing aerial photos is a goal, prioritize drones with stabilized cameras, ideally 2K or 4K resolution. However, higher-quality cameras often add complexity and cost, so assess whether you need professional-level footage or just beginner snapshots. Many affordable drones include basic cameras suitable for casual photography, but they may lack stabilization or have limited control over image quality. Remember, camera features should not compromise flight stability or ease of use, especially for new pilots.

Portability and Durability

Lightweight, foldable designs make it easier to carry your drone around and protect it during transport. Durability is equally important, as beginners are more likely to crash. Look for models with reinforced frames and simple maintenance routines. Investing in a protective case or extra propellers can save money and frustration over time. Larger, more complex drones may provide more features but tend to be less portable and more prone to damage when mishandled.

Price and Value

In the beginner drone market, price often reflects feature sets. While budget options can be suitable for casual flying, investing a bit more can provide better stability, longer flight times, and enhanced safety features. Avoid models that are overly cheap, as they may lack basic controls or crash-proofing. Conversely, very expensive drones might offer features beyond a beginner’s needs, making them less practical for new pilots still learning to fly. Striking the right balance depends on your specific goals and budget.

Frequently Asked Questions

How difficult is it to learn to fly a drone for beginners?

Learning to fly a drone for beginners is generally straightforward if you choose a model with beginner-friendly features like altitude hold and headless mode. These features help stabilize the drone and simplify controls, reducing the risk of crashes. Most new pilots find that with some practice, basic flying becomes intuitive within a few hours. Patience and starting in open, obstacle-free areas are key to building confidence quickly and avoiding frustration.

What is the ideal flight time for a beginner drone?

For beginners, a flight time of 10 to 20 minutes per charge offers a good balance between practice and convenience. Shorter flights can be enough for practicing takeoffs, landings, and basic maneuvers, but longer durations reduce the number of charges needed and improve skill acquisition. If you plan to fly frequently, consider models with multiple batteries or quick-swap systems to extend your flying sessions without interruption.

Are GPS features necessary for beginner drones?

GPS features are highly beneficial for beginners because they enable functions like auto return, precise hover, and follow-me modes. These features make flying safer and easier, especially in outdoor environments. However, GPS modules add cost and complexity, so if you’re just starting out with casual flying, a drone without GPS can still be suitable—just be prepared for more manual control and potential for crashes.

Should I prioritize camera quality or flight stability?

This decision depends on your main interest. If capturing photos or videos is a priority, look for drones with stabilized 2K or 4K cameras. However, higher-quality cameras often come with increased weight and complexity, which can impact flight stability for beginners. If you’re primarily focused on learning to fly, prioritize stability and ease of control first, and consider adding photography capabilities later once you’re comfortable.

How important are the size and portability of a beginner drone?

Size and portability are important considerations, especially if you plan to take your drone on trips or store it easily. Smaller, foldable models are easier to carry and less intimidating for beginners to handle. However, very tiny drones might be more fragile and less stable in windy conditions. Balancing portability with durability and flight performance will help you find a drone that’s suitable for your flying environment and skill level.
